The .gov.cn domain name is reserved for the websites of Party and government agencies in China, or entities legally authorized to perform government functions. To register a .gov.cn domain name, your organization must have an Organization Code Certificate and be classified as a government legal entity. Businesses and individuals cannot register. This topic describes how to complete the real-name verification for a .gov.cn domain name.

Procedure

  1. Log in to the Alibaba Cloud Domains console.

  2. On the Domain List page, in the All Domain Statuses drop-down list, click Unverified, locate the target domain name, and click Submit Documents in the Actions column.

  3. On the Domain Name Holder Real-Name Verification page, follow the instructions on the page to fill in and upload your real-name verification information.

    For detailed instructions on how to fill in the information and upload documents, see Sample (organization).

  4. After you fill in your real-name information and upload your documents, click Submit.

  5. Follow the on-screen instructions to download the .gov.cn domain name registration application form, and then complete and submit it based on the following requirements.

Application form requirements

Download, print, complete, and stamp the .gov.cn domain name registration application form with your official seal. A sample and the requirements are provided below.

Instructions:

  • The applicant organization must ensure that the information provided is true, accurate, and complete.

  • Items marked with an asterisk (*) are required. Apply a clear official seal and ensure that the "Registrant" name on the application form is consistent with the name on the official seal and the registrant name in the registration system.

  • A single government agency can register and hold no more than two ".gov.cn" domain names: one for its portal website and one for its Internet email system.

  • After receiving your application, CNNIC will call you to verify the registration details. The registration contact or the person responsible for registration matters should be available for this follow-up call and cooperate to complete the verification.

Important
  • The domain name, registrant contact, registrant, registrant phone number, registrar, and registrant ID fields in the "Domain Name Registration Application Form" are automatically generated based on the information you provide during domain name registration. Fill in the domain name registration information according to the requirements in the application form.

  • The applicant organization is solely responsible for any legal liabilities arising from information in the application form that is untrue, inaccurate, or incomplete.
